Optimism comes from the Latin word optimus,meaning "best" which describes how an optimist person is always looking for the best in any situation and expecting good things to happen.Optimism is the tendency to believe,expect or hope that things will turn out well.Optimism is the idea that there is always a positive outcome,no matter the situation.The paper cites some case studies.Both Delta Airlines and Starbucks Coffee,China's Summer Olympic games,China's recent space mission,India's first unmanned Moon mission despite criticism provide examples of how optimism can have an effect on a company's or a country's overall performance.Optimistic people indulge in positive thinking,are achievement/goaloriented explain good and events in their lives.Optimistic people view bad events/difficulties as temporary,limited and caused by something other than themselves.They face difficult times and adversity with hope.
